Различия в SQL Server: версия Web Edition vs Express Edition с расширенными рядами

103
14

Я знаю, что это звучит глупо, но просто для любопытства, я спрашиваю об этом.


Я разрабатываю веб-приложение на Microsoft SQL Server Express Edition с расширенными службами (64-разрядная версия). Мой клиент имеет SQL Server 2008 Web Edition. Поэтому я просто хочу узнать о проблемах совместимости или различиях между ними, поскольку я должен развернуть экспресс-версию в веб-версии.


Обратите внимание: у нас нет каких-либо расширенных функций, таких как Reporting, Analysis, BI. У нас есть просто CRUD-операции с триггерами и представлениями и т.д. Мы могли бы выполнять задания для резервного копирования на нашем сервере.

спросил(а) 2021-01-19T22:22:24+03:00 9 месяцев назад
1
Решение
102

Экспресс и веб-версия - это точно такая же база кода, точно такой же формат файла базы данных - здесь не ожидается никаких проблем.


Вы можете:

    развертывание с использованием сценариев SQL в новой базе данных веб-изданий
    или вы даже можете создать резервную копию/восстановить свою базу данных из своей версии Express на сервер веб-изданий.

Более важный момент: он должен быть той же версией, например. как 2008, или 2008 R2 - не смешивайте их! Вы не можете восстановить резервную копию более новой версии на более раннюю версию SQL Server (например, вы не смогли создать резервную копию базы данных SQL Server 2008 R2 Express, а затем восстановить ее на экземпляр веб-издания SQL Server 2008). Путь с использованием SQL-скриптов всегда работает, хотя

ответил(а) 2021-01-19T22:22:24+03:00 9 месяцев назад
Ваш ответ
Введите минимум 50 символов
Чтобы , пожалуйста,
Выберите тему жалобы:

Другая проблема